Roofing repairs vary based on a few key factors. The total square footage of the damaged area, the accessibility of your roof, and the specific materials needed for a proper patch all play a role. If there is underlying rot or water damage to the deck beneath your shingles, that adds to the labor and supplies required. Proper insulation acts as a thermal barrier, keeping your conditioned air inside and outdoor temperatures out. It helps lower your energy bills and prevents ice dams from forming in the winter by keeping the roof deck temperature consistent. A single-ply roofing membrane is a flexible sheet material used for flat or low-slope roofs, often seen on commercial buildings but also suitable for certain residential applications in Jurupa Valley. Materials like TPO, EPDM, and PVC are common examples, offering good waterproofing and durability against the Inland Empire's sun. Choosing metal roof colors for your Jurupa Valley home involves balancing aesthetics with energy efficiency. Lighter colors can reflect more sunlight, potentially reducing cooling costs, while darker colors offer a bolder look. Consider how the color will complement your home's exterior and landscaping.
